Before, it was longed for. Then, made official. Finally, postponed. The special of Friends, which the Coronavirus has imposed a premature stop, has met a troubled production, which the new year could, however, put a stop to. Lisa Kudrow, Phoebe from the original series, confirmed that she was called to the set, to shoot the first scenes of what she called a “reunion” moment.
“We’ve already shot a few things,” said the actress, host of Rob Lowe’s podcast.
“We’re really doing it, but it’s not a script-based production. We’re not playing our characters, ”Kudrow reiterated, explaining how the special revolves around a sincere, spontaneous reunion between friends. “It is we who meet”, he clarified, “What, this, that doesn’t happen very often. It is since 2004, when we stopped, that we have not found ourselves in front of other people. I think it will be fantastic, ”concluded Kudrow, who, together with Friends original, will come back star of a one-hour special, for which each is said to have earned three to four million dollars.
